    The Growing Threat of AI Hallucinations: Security Risks in Critical Infrastructure

    As AI integration deepens across industries, a critical warning has emerged regarding the security risks posed by AI hallucinations. A report from The Hacker News highlights how AI models, when lacking certainty, can generate highly confident yet incorrect outputs, exploiting human trust in critical infrastructure decision-making.

    These hallucinated outputs, which may cite nonexistent sources or fabricate data, pose significant dangers, especially when informing real-world security decisions or feeding directly into automated systems. An evaluation in 2025 found that most AI models were more likely to provide a confident, incorrect answer than a correct one on difficult questions. Experts urge organizations to treat every AI-generated response as a potential vulnerability until human verification, emphasizing the need for robust security frameworks, least-privilege access for AI systems, and continuous auditing of training data to mitigate these risks.

    Meta AI Unveils ‘Digital Twin’ of Human Neural Activity

    In a monumental leap for artificial intelligence and neuroscience, Meta AI has introduced TRIBE v2, a predictive foundation model engineered as a ‘digital twin of human neural activity’. This groundbreaking AI is capable of forecasting brain responses to intricate stimuli, encompassing sights, sounds, and language. Trained on an extensive dataset from over 700 volunteers, TRIBE v2 achieves a remarkable 70-fold increase in resolution compared to previous models.

    The implications of this breakthrough are profound. By simulating high-resolution neural patterns in silico, scientists can now test hypotheses about brain processing without constant reliance on human participants, significantly accelerating discovery cycles for neurological disorders affecting hundreds of millions globally. Furthermore, the insights gained are expected to feed directly back into AI design, fostering more robust, efficient, and human-aligned systems.

    Alarm Bells Ring: Two-Thirds of Enterprises Suspect AI Agent Data Breaches

    Amidst the rapid deployment of AI agents across enterprises, a new global study by Akeyless reveals a concerning security landscape: two-thirds of organizations suspect their AI agents have already accessed data beyond their intended scope. This alarming statistic, based on a survey of 400 IT and security leaders, underscores a widening gap between AI operational speed and current security protocols.

    The report highlights that it takes an average of 14 hours to detect a compromised AI agent, followed by nearly a week for containment and remediation. The core issue often lies with AI agents being granted static identities and long-lived credentials, which, combined with the agents’ millisecond-level actions, create critical windows for unauthorized access. Only 7% of organizations believe their existing controls could prevent a compromised agent from operating effectively. This necessitates a paradigm shift towards continuous, real-time governance of AI agents at runtime.

    Blackstone Fortifies E-commerce Footprint with Skroutz Acquisition

    In a significant move in the e-commerce sector, global alternative asset manager Blackstone Inc. has finalized an agreement to acquire a majority stake in Skroutz, Greece’s leading online marketplace. This strategic investment from CVC Capital Partners Fund VII aims to expand Blackstone’s presence in the burgeoning e-commerce markets of Greece and Southeast Europe, regions that currently exhibit lower e-commerce penetration compared to Western Europe, thus presenting substantial growth opportunities. Skroutz, established in 2005, has evolved into a comprehensive platform offering over 12 million products from approximately 9,000 merchants to 2.5 million active users, complete with integrated logistics, fulfillment services, and fintech capabilities. The founders will retain a stake and continue to lead the company, with George Chatzigeorgiou remaining CEO.

    Alarming First: AI Weaponized for Zero-Day 2FA Bypass

    A disturbing development in cybersecurity has emerged, with Google disclosing the identification of an unknown threat actor who likely leveraged an AI system to develop a zero-day exploit. This exploit successfully bypassed two-factor authentication (2FA) on a widely used open-source, web-based system administration tool. This incident marks the first confirmed instance of AI technology being weaponized in the wild for malicious vulnerability discovery and exploit generation, signaling a critical new frontier in cyber threats and underscoring the escalating need for advanced defensive AI strategies.
